Tyler, the Creator celebrated the release of his new album Call Me If You Get Lost by copping a shiny new chain.
The diamond-studded pendant, inspired by Tyler’s alter ego Tyler Baudelaire, features a gold bellhop carrying two pink suitcases. According to TMZ, the necklace cost a whopping $500,000, with more than 186 carats in diamonds, 60 carats in sapphires, and 23,515 hand-set stones.
Tyler reached out to celebrity jeweler Alex Moss about seven months ago and gave him a reference for the chain and they worked on the design together. It took Alex four months to find the colored diamonds for it.
Tyler showed off his half-a-million-dollar accessory on the red carpet at Sunday’s BET Awards, where he performed “LUMBERJACK” for the first time.
The Grammy-winning rapper has a lot to celebrate. Call Me If You Get Lost, which features Lil Wayne, Pharrell, and Lil Uzi Vert, is expected to debut at No. 1 on next week’s Billboard 200 with 185,000 equivalent album units, his largest sales week yet.
